Memory Verse:

“Love your enemies.” (Luke 6:27).

Memory verse activity:

Use a hoop, chalk, piece of string, or cardboard etc to make a
large circle on the floor. Children stand around the circle then
take three giant steps backwards. They should now be facing
the circle but a short distance away.
• Have a ball for each child. Each child
tries to roll their stone into the marked circle. If it reaches the
circle they recite the memory verse and sit down.
• If the stone misses, they have another go from where it landed
until it is in.
• Repeat until all children have had a turn.

Story:

Acts 6&7
Story Summary
1. Stephen was wise and filled with the Holy
Spirit.
2. He was chosen to help out, so that the
apostles could spend their time teaching.
3. Stephen’s enemies told lies about him
and took him to court. When the council
looked at him they thought he had a face
like an angel.
4. He spoke to them about how God had
used faithful men like Abraham, Jacob,
Joseph and Moses to guide Israel.
5. He reminded them how often they had
refused to listen to God’s messengers and
that they had killed God’s Son, Jesus.
6. The people became angry with Stephen,
dragged him out of the city.
7. They threw stones at him until he died, but
before he died, Stephen asked the Lord to
forgive these people.

Craft:

. Make a ‘face like an angel’. Before class, cut the centre out
of paper plates (one for each child) and attach a paddlepop
stick to the bottom of each. The children can then decorate
the rim of the plate with glitter, stars, alfoil. Hold over face to
produce their very own angel face.
